TERMS & CONDITIONS

These Booking Terms & Conditions form a contract between KH VENUES LTD trading as The Event Rooms and the person or organisation making the booking.

KH VENUES LTD provides venue hire only. Any add-ons, extras, bar services, drinks arrangements or additional event services are supplied separately by The Eventists and/or other third-party suppliers, unless otherwise agreed in writing.

By confirming a booking, the Client agrees to follow these Terms & Conditions. If a booking is made on behalf of an organisation, the person confirming the booking confirms that they have authority to agree to these Terms & Conditions on behalf of that organisation.

1. Booking and Payment

A booking is only confirmed once KH VENUES LTD has received the required initial payment and the Client has accepted these Terms & Conditions.

The person who confirms the booking will be treated as the Client and will be responsible for the booking, payments, guests, suppliers and compliance with these Terms & Conditions.

Unless otherwise agreed in writing, the required initial payment is 50% of the total Hire Fee. The remaining 50% of the Hire Fee is due no later than 14 days before the event date.

Payment plans may be available for the full amount, subject to agreement by KH VENUES LTD. Clients should contact KH VENUES LTD for more information before confirming their booking. Any payment plan agreed must be confirmed in writing.

4. Cancellation under Standard Terms

All cancellations must be made in writing.

If the Client cancels all or part of the booking, the following cancellation charges will apply unless Flexi Terms have been selected at the time of booking and paid for within the required timeframe.

If the Client cancels within 7 days of placing the booking, no cancellation fee will be payable, unless the event date is within 14 days of the booking date.

If the Client cancels more than 112 days before the event date, 25% of the total Hire Fee will be payable.

If the Client cancels between 15 and 112 days before the event date, 50% of the total Hire Fee will be payable.

If the Client cancels between 0 and 14 days before the event date, 100% of the total Hire Fee will be payable.

If the event date is within 14 days of the booking date, the cancellation fee will be 100% of the total Hire Fee.

Any add-ons, extras, supplier costs, third-party costs, bespoke purchases or additional event services may be non-refundable and may be subject to separate cancellation terms.

4a. Postponements under Standard Terms

Postponements are not available under the Standard Terms.

If the Client wishes to postpone an event under the Standard Terms, this will be treated as a cancellation and the cancellation charges above will apply.

5. Flexi Terms Add-On

Clients may choose to add Flexi Terms to their booking for an additional fee equal to 10% of the total Hire Fee.

Flexi Terms must be requested and added at the time the booking is signed and the initial payment is made. If Flexi Terms are selected, KH VENUES LTD will send a payment link for the Flexi Terms fee.

The Flexi Terms fee must be paid within 4 days of placing the booking. If the Flexi Terms fee is not paid within 4 days of placing the booking, Flexi Terms will not be added to the booking and the booking will remain subject to the Standard Terms set out in Clause 4 above.

Where Flexi Terms have been selected and paid for within the required timeframe, the Client will benefit from the enhanced cancellation and postponement options set out below.

5a. Cancellation under Flexi Terms

If the Client cancels the booking more than 14 days before the event date, no cancellation fee will be payable in respect of the Hire Fee.

If the Client cancels the booking within 14 days of the event date, 25% of the total Hire Fee will remain payable.

The Flexi Terms fee is non-refundable once paid.

5b. Postponement under Flexi Terms

Clients who have purchased Flexi Terms may request one postponement of their event date without charge, provided the request is made in writing more than 14 days before the event date.

Any postponed date is subject to availability and must be agreed in writing by KH VENUES LTD.

The new event date must be confirmed within the timeframe specified by KH VENUES LTD.

If the Client postpones their event under Flexi Terms and later cancels the postponed booking, the booking will revert to the Standard Terms cancellation policy set out in Clause 4 above.

5c. What Flexi Terms Apply To

Flexi Terms apply to the Hire Fee only.

Flexi Terms do not apply to add-ons, extras or additional services, as these are supplied separately by The Eventists and/or third-party suppliers and may be subject to separate terms, payment requirements and cancellation terms.

Flexi Terms cannot be added retrospectively after the booking has been signed and paid.

Flexi Terms cannot be added after a cancellation or postponement request has been made.

KH VENUES LTD reserves the right to refuse to offer Flexi Terms on selected dates, peak dates, discounted bookings, bespoke packages or bookings made at short notice.

Except where expressly amended by the Flexi Terms, all other Standard Terms & Conditions continue to apply.

8. Drinks and Bar Arrangements

All drinks and bar arrangements must be agreed in writing before the event.

KH VENUES LTD provides venue hire only and does not operate the licensed bar.

Where bar services, drinks packages, welcome drinks, drinks tokens or related services are agreed, these are supplied separately by The Eventists and/or other agreed suppliers and may be subject to separate terms.

No outside drinks may be brought into the premises unless this has been agreed in writing by KH VENUES LTD before the event.

Where a bar is operating, any person who appears to be under 25 may be asked to provide valid photographic ID before being served alcohol.

KH VENUES LTD, The Eventists, management, door staff and security reserve the right to refuse service, refuse entry, remove guests, stop alcohol service, close the bar or end an event where they consider it necessary for safety, licensing, legal or operational reasons.

If the event runs until the end of licensed hours, the bar may be required to close 15 minutes before the end of the event. Music must stop no later than 15 minutes after the bar closes, and all guests must leave the premises no later than 30 minutes after the bar closes.
